Untying The Knot
Roderick Phillips, author of the highly acclaimed history of Divorce, Putting Asunder, has now abridged his fascinating and wide-ranging study for general readership. Encompassing religious and secular attitudes to divorce, the evolution of divorce laws, and changing responses to marriage breakdown, Untying the Knot offers a highly readable and thought-provoking history of the phenomenon.

The rapid spread of divorce since the 1960s has dramatically affected family life in Western society. Extensive research has been devoted to this recent period of change, and yet the long-term history of divorce has remained surprisingly obscure.
